Hoppy,
Posting on the BOI is limited to "verified" (ie paid) members of the site. It costs as little as $10/year to be verified. Having a "signature line" is also restricted to paying members through the "User Control Panel". A desciption of the different membership levels and their benefits can be seen at http://www.faunaclassifieds.com/foru...ad.php?t=64541.
For a description of the Reputation Point and Reputation Power system, read http://www.faunaclassifieds.com/foru...ad.php?t=58415. Simply put, one's reputation power determines how much effect one's "opinion" of a post is "worth". If someone has a repuation power of 50, then a postive opinion left of a post nets the person 50 reputation points. A negative opinion would result in half that amount, or 25 points, being deducted from the other person's total. Everyone starts with 10 reputation points. You have 113 because someone (me) gave you 103 for a good post (when my repuation power was 103 a few days ago). Your reputation power stays at 0 until you have 100 posts or if your reputation points are in the red. After that your reputation power increases with time, with every 100 posts, and with every 100 repuation points that you acquire.
Trader Rating points come from others with whom you have done business and can be accessed by clicking on the number of your rating.
